ST6200 STMICROELECTRONICS [STMicroelectronics], ST6200 Datasheet - Page 54

no-image

ST6200

Manufacturer Part Number
ST6200
Description
8-BIT MCUs WITH A/D CONVERTER, TWO TIMERS, OSCILLATOR SAFEGUARD & SAFE RESET
Manufacturer
STMICROELECTRONICS [STMicroelectronics]
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
ST6200
Manufacturer:
ST
0
Part Number:
ST6200/HSP
Manufacturer:
ST
0
Part Number:
ST6200C/MIJ
Manufacturer:
ST
0
Part Number:
ST6200CB1
Manufacturer:
ST
0
Part Number:
ST6200CB1/MML
Manufacturer:
ST
0
Part Number:
ST6200CM6/MSETF
Manufacturer:
ST
Quantity:
20 000
Part Number:
ST6200QNL
Manufacturer:
PULSE10
Quantity:
58
Part Number:
ST6200T
Manufacturer:
ST
Quantity:
20 000
ST6200C/ST6201C/ST6203C
INSTRUCTION SET (Cont’d)
Arithmetic and Logic. These instructions are
used to perform arithmetic calculations and logic
operations. In AND, ADD, CP, SUB instructions
one operand is always the accumulator while, de-
pending on the addressing mode, the other can be
Table 16. Arithmetic & Logic Instructions
Notes:
X,Y
V, W Short Direct Registers
54/100
1
DEC A
DEC rr
DEC (X)
DEC (Y)
INC X
INC Y
INC V
INC W
INC A
INC rr
INC (X)
INC (Y)
RLC A
SLA A
SUB A, (X)
SUB A, (Y)
SUB A, rr
SUBI A, #N
ADD A, (X)
ADD A, (Y)
ADD A, rr
ADDI A, #N
AND A, (X)
AND A, (Y)
AND A, rr
ANDI A, #N
CLR A
CLR r
COM A
CP A, (X)
CP A, (Y)
CP A, rr
CPI A, #N
DEC X
DEC Y
DEC V
DEC W
Index Registers
Affected
Instruction
Indirect
Inherent
Inherent
Indirect
Indirect
Direct
Immediate
Indirect
Indirect
Direct
Immediate
Short Direct
Direct
Inherent
Indirect
Indirect
Direct
Immediate
Short Direct
Short Direct
Short Direct
Short Direct
Direct
Direct
Indirect
Indirect
Short Direct
Short Direct
Short Direct
Short Direct
Direct
Direct
Indirect
Indirect
Indirect
Direct
Immediate
Addressing Mode
Bytes
2
1
1
1
1
1
2
2
1
1
1
2
1
1
2
2
1
1
2
2
1
1
2
2
2
3
1
1
1
2
2
1
1
1
1
2
1
either a data space memory location or an imme-
diate value. In CLR, DEC, INC instructions the op-
erand can be any of the 256 data space address-
es. In COM, RLC, SLA the operand is always the
accumulator.
# Immediate data (stored in ROM memory)
*
rr Data space register
Not Affected
Cycles
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
4
Z
*
Flags
C
*
*
*
*
*
*
*
*
*
*
*
*
*
*
*
*
*

Related parts for ST6200